Goals and Outcomes

Outcomes

After completing this module, students will be able to:

  • upload a PowerPoint, Keynote, or PDF files to slideshare.net
  • embed slideshare onto a webpage
  • add audio to a slideshare slide
  • create and deploy a poll with Poll Everywhere
  • view the poll responses inside Poll Everywhere
  • import media to VoiceThread
  • add commentary to a media inside VocieThread
  • share a media inside VoiceThread
  • create and modify a presentation with Prezi
  • embed Prezi content onto a web page

Discussions

Using A Presentation Tool for My Teaching

In this module, several online tools are introduced for presenting your instructional materials. Pick one of these tools and describe how you can use it for your teaching practice. You need to specify your subject area and grade level. Please be as detailed as possible so that others can duplicate your instructional idea.

Make your initial posts before 11:59 p.m. U.S. EST/EDT on Day 5 of this module. After making your initial postings, review at least two of your classmates’ postings and reply to their threads. Complete your replies before 11:59 p.m. U.S. EST/EDT on the next Monday.

Discussion postings should always be thoughtful and courteous and include some references or direct evidence from the module’s content, readings, or assignments to support your statements. In order to ensure that postings are appropriate in length and substance, please limit your initial postings to 100 – 200 words and each of your responses to 25 – 50 words.
